String 字符串类型,它的比较值用compareTo方法,它从第一位开始比较,,如果遇到不同的字符,则马上返回这两个字符的ASCII码的差值,返回值是int类型; 一、当两个比较的字符串是英文且长度不等: 1、当长度短的字符与长度长的字符的内容一致时,返回的是两个字符串长度的差值; 代码语言:javascript 代码运行次数:0 运...
代码语言:javascript 代码运行次数:0 运行 AI代码解释 publicvirtual intCompare(string string1,string string2,CompareOptions options){if(options==CompareOptions.OrdinalIgnoreCase){returnstring.Compare(string1,string2,StringComparison.OrdinalIgnoreCase);}if((options&CompareOptions.Ordinal)!=CompareOptions.None){if...
Javascript 中 Array的 sort()和 compare()方法 Javascript 中 Array的 sort()方法其实是把要排序的内容转化为string(调用 toString()), 然后按照字符串的第一位 ascii 码先后顺序进行比较,不是数字。 我们看看官方是怎么说的: arrayobj.sort(sortfunction) 参数 arrayObj 必选项。任意Array对象。 sortFunction 可...
String (Standard - JavaScript) Syntax compareTo(str:string) :int ParametersDescription strThe comparison string. ReturnsDescription int0 if the two strings are equal. Usage String 1 is this object. String 2 is the parameter. If the two strings are equal, the return value is 0. If the strin...
直接用localeCompare确实不太可靠localeCompare还接收两个参数,locales和optionsreferenceStr.localeCompare(compareString[, locales[, options]]) 这两个参数可以进一步指定比较规则,使结果符合预期 https://developer.mozilla.org...有用 回复 撰写回答 你尚未登录,登录后可以 和开发者交流问题的细节 关注并接收问题和回...
javascript中除了上面的基本类型(number,string,boolean,null,undefined)之外就是引用类型了,也可以说是就是对象了。对象是属性和方法的集合。也就是说引用类型可以拥有属性和方法,属性又可以包含基本类型和引用类型。来看看引用类型的一些特性: 1.引用类型的值是可变的 ...
Java String类 compareTo() 方法用于两种方式的比较: 字符串与对象进行比较。 按字典顺序比较两个字符串。 语法 intcompareTo(Objecto)或intcompareTo(StringanotherString) 参数 o-- 要比较的对象。 anotherString-- 要比较的字符串。 返回值 返回值是整型,它是先比较对应字符的大小(ASCII码顺序),如果第一个字...
publicbooleancompareString(Stringstr1,Stringstr2){returnstr1.equals(str2);} 1. 2. 3. 步骤3:调用比较方法 在主程序中,我们需要调用比较方法来进行对比操作。可以通过以下代码调用之前定义的比较字符串相等的方法: booleanresult=compareString(str1,str2); ...
`In JavaScript this is not legal.` console.log(`string text line 1 string text line 2`); // 字符串中嵌入变量 let name = "Bob", time = "today"; `Hello ${name}, how are you ${time}?` 1. 2. 3. 4. 5. 6. 7. 8.
2015-09-14 23:10 −Javascript 中 Array的 sort()方法其实是把要排序的内容转化为string(调用 toString()), 然后按照字符串的第一位 ascii 码先后顺序进行比较,不是数字。 我们看看官方是怎么说的: arrayobj.sort(sortfunction) &nbs... 还是小黑 ...